Firefox was not remembering complete logon info for a particular site. I removed the page from the Saved Passwords hoping it would resave next time I went to the site, but no such luck. How do I get FF to remember passwords for a particular site again?

Make sure that you do not have that site in the exceptions: Tools > Options > Security: Passwords: Exceptions

If a site uses autocomplete="off" then look at this article for a bookmarklet to remove that autocomplete attribute. http://kb.mozillazine.org/User_name_and_password_not_remembered (bookmarklet) http://kb.mozillazine.org/Password_Manager
